> Why is cindent in the core of vim? Why does C get special treatment?
> At first glance it makes it seem like vim has a language bias. I don't
> know the history though. *Is* it from vi?

C gets special treatment. See 'cindent', 'cscope', etc.
Lisp gets special treatment. See 'lispwords', etc.
nroff gets special treatment. See 'sections', 'paragraphs'.
And so on.
